The objective of this course is to offer students an opportunity to work in an
architects office and get acquainted with the demands of the profession,
including carrying out independent critical study of a building of architectural
importance, study of an innovative building material and study of observed
and drafted details.
Course contents:
The professional training shall be for duration of one year split in two
semesters (as mentioned above) in various aspects of architectural practice.
During every semester, the candidate shall produce three reports viz., Training
Report, Building Study Report, and Building Material Study.
The Training Report shall consist of various drawings, observations, technical
graphic data, etc. worked on, during the process of training both at office and
sites.
The Building Study Report shall be a critical appraisal of one of the noted
buildings designed and supervised by the firm in which the candidate is
undergoing his/her training.
The Building Material Study Report shall include pertinent data, characteristics,
applications and constructional details of a contemporary building material.
The Building Details report shall consist of a wide range of innovative and
unique details with respect to construction, materials/finishes and aesthetics.
The details should cover aspects of interior design, landscape design, technical
design, product design, faade design and others.
A minimum of 5 details shall be done under each of the above aspects.
Professional training shall be carried out as per the prescribed professional
training rules. Students are required to go through the manual before
commencement of professional training.

3.0 KIND OF EXPOSURE EXPECTED
Exposure to the various aspects of Architectural Practice:
1. Design and Technical:
a. Designing/Planning
b. Site visits along with the architect or a deputy
c. Corporation / Municipal Sanction Drawings
d. Working Drawings
e. Construction Details
f. Interior Details
g. Services details
i. Plumbing and Sanitation Drawings
ii. Electrical
iii. Air Conditioning
iv. Lift Details
v. Fire Fighting Services
h. Acoustical and Thermal Insulation Details
i. Structural Drawings
j. Specification and BOQ
k. Estimation and Costing (of at least one project)
2. Contract administration and project management
a. Tenders and tendering process
b. Conditions of Contract
3. Office administration and management
a. Understand office procedures
5
b. Involvement in meeting with the Clients
c. Prepare minutes of meetings
d. Measured Drawing and Documentation
4.0 COMPILATION OF REPORTS
4.1 Training Report
The training report will consist of
Original joining report on letterhead of the organization duly signed by the
Principal Architect along with the seal and COA registration number.
Original completion certificate on letterhead of the organization duly
signed by the Principal Architect along with the seal and COA registration
number.
The work dairy of six months showing the works done on every working
day.
Original monthly log sheets.
Copies of the drawings done by the student in the office duly signed by the
supervisor. Only those drawings worked on by the student should be
included in the report. It may also contain details of site visits, sketches and
minutes of meetings prepared by the student.
A minimum 2-page write-up about the experiences of the professional
training. The write up can have anecdotes and visuals also.
The report should be in minimum A3 format.
All sketches should be hand-drawn.
6
4.2 Building Study Report
The building study report shall consist of
A complete study and appraisal of the building giving due considerations to
function, form, construction technology, structural systems, services,
materials, costing and project management. Should include appropriate and
adequate illustrations.
The study should include wide range of construction details. All details to
be hand-drafted. Minimum of 5 details to be provided. Photographs, if
used, should only be to reinforce sketches.
The study should include the factors which influenced the design based on
the discussions with the architect who designed the building.
The report should include a POST OCCUPANCY EVALUATION after
speaking to the users of the finished building.
The report should be in A4 portrait format. The written matter should be
done in Arial 12 font with 1.5 line spacing and 25 mm margin all around.
4.3 Building Material Study
A well-researched and exhaustive study of any interesting building material
used locally in the town/city where the student works.
This must include physical characteristics, applications, scope and limitation
of the use, and cost factors.
The report should include samples of the material.
The report should be in A4 portrait format. The written matter should be
done in Arial 12 font with 1.5 line spacing and 25mm margin all around.

5.0 ASSESSMENT
Assessment of student training will be based on student performance in the
viva-voce, the training report, the building study report, and building material
study report at the end of each training period.
Professional Training has a total of 450 marks and 25 credits for each stage.
Confidential Evaluation Reports about the performance of the trainee will also
be obtained from the Principal Architect / Office Supervisor. These reports will
be considered for final evaluation during the viva-voce.
Breakup of Marks:
1. Training Report: 300 marks which will be evaluated during external Viva
Voce examination.
2. Building Study: 40 marks out of 150
3. Building Material Study: 40 marks out of 150
4. Building Details Study: 40 marks out of 150
5. On time submission of original joining report, original completion
certificate, work dairy, monthly logs: 30 marks out of 150
8
Evaluation of Professional Training
The evaluation for the Professional Training will be done at two stages, first at
the end of the ninth semester and second at the end of the tenth semester.
The internal evaluation for both the stages of the Practical Training will be
done for 150 marks for each stage and will be based on the reports submitted
by the student as per the training manual.
The End-semester viva-voce evaluations at both the stages will be done by a
jury consisting of two examiners the Training Coordinator and the External
Examiner, who will be a practicing architect. The evaluation for each stage will
be out of 300 marks, with both the jury members evaluating the student for
150 marks each.
The grade awarded to the student will be on the basis of the total marks
obtained by him/her out of 900.
A candidate who is unable to clear the Professional Training viva examination
either in stage 1 or stage 2 shall repeat the training afresh for 6 months
immediately after the second stage of training i.e from June 2015to November
2015.
If the candidate is unable to clear the Professional Training viva examination in
both stage 1 & stage 2 he/she shall repeat the training for 1 year in the
academic year 2015-2016.
